From patchwork Fri May 8 07:11:30 2026 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Yoann Congal X-Patchwork-Id: 87715 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id B6582CD37B7 for ; Fri, 8 May 2026 07:12:40 +0000 (UTC) Received: from mail-wr1-f52.google.com (mail-wr1-f52.google.com [209.85.221.52]) by mx.groups.io with SMTP id smtpd.msgproc02-g2.8244.1778224359644975156 for ; Fri, 08 May 2026 00:12:39 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@smile.fr header.s=google header.b=kHK4eI5R; spf=pass (domain: smile.fr, ip: 209.85.221.52, mailfrom: yoann.congal@smile.fr) Received: by mail-wr1-f52.google.com with SMTP id ffacd0b85a97d-444826c16ffso1480719f8f.1 for ; Fri, 08 May 2026 00:12:39 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=smile.fr; s=google; t=1778224358; x=1778829158; darn=lists.openembedded.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:from:to:cc:subject:date:message-id :reply-to; bh=IoGbV2KrM0sj6e+pfcEyUMy0Bs9exLsM+I8XkFj35h4=; b=kHK4eI5Rb0BrGWET//xzUy+GMpeCKX7FZR9clBfVd6cB1HKX3n3p6O5JNx/tIZSlpS +jPTDMf60DJvGN7jsseTnhZBG5u56e9QglCk/wLfjRK7nqwg2IsuHi+YxU7MdCweh7N+ 7PauJtpN9iezfJjSAR5ROJnEWGkt8/L5iYGW0=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1778224358; x=1778829158;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:x-gm-gg:x-gm-message-state:from:to :cc:subject:date:message-id:reply-to; bh=IoGbV2KrM0sj6e+pfcEyUMy0Bs9exLsM+I8XkFj35h4=; b=jU9AU546CeZcPFXUDZIiNYvYGiKVcaaCVSa8cViLVxf4YliVlq/HNkwggpM2Hl04KM FSEng0LPUARbHn8XqgCntMVXzgndOdykwaJ4ph0QFM450PJydEQj+xepBRPMnsSo2cJv pnoV/XQoFejPW5Yq1sT1FINsu8xngHC1N0Z8rpYnRvSdF0l0FumuZxt/lVMQHZpvhJUL H+zH+wNtkqE4kwFvvvTBDoB+i/qvGILYoeTa99gsz3DcgQzyb40/h+zqzrKnvAA2jpCN y9i1IerbcDbM6cjw3maptsbe1qUUN7obwuFC0KPlM+W4hIdS/kj3cKjpK90lmn3gJArX +O6g== X-Gm-Message-State: AOJu0Yyx6CE30P9WnMSfxdbH7BU9+wwZqgTiekqbAcaBl25Ra7Q4F5kz VQCgmuMmx2AmbPDqJmZTd9JpxpTIUI71D3FnuJBw2wjsnlECZtbUwUDhlw+ndlZXNZXGADKZSJd Z2f1dvTM= X-Gm-Gg: Acq92OEyg07+TPgL1uoJnjGTgO1q9JPIDFjpMwmjFtx1Dz0vHaoWo7M7U/imfEySSYH RCCwl5U1PFdYAsR+NsgHSu+jA/HkOsv0qevPknGT4zASTqhCoqhwSWCNj+dWUq2ADNVXDYHYYGS keugJmK61Hd+EisiaeS519nwCS+oz12UX/gOfE7FACkgJnUDlgE2X5VI005ZGaozDKJ8C7nrrpe ZTBRkW08z9ZY5wNH4Wr4721+b3vYYnCid27xGptbSbx3lYThLV07/7FUBNOzR6cuABuq2AKiDUg AxPrY5Iz5DVu6OdX6Vtdy7tG4uBkmIAa4kdrB3fxEJkNGKe0HN4DQ3avp/S+7l+cUiNS2Yz0+y7 A7dGH0LZDxGWYbCR4Eo1uVOswezsqc+KyTlzjYtsuzHduh0gT61k5QsTDnP/WexdlCrXqp4agS6 0ulrydXOPQ45h86TCoCYImlLNBFBjb6YsS9gJNHp05jWmRyyW1WWiIMhZVFplqB341jbjO/xhXu 2JmLa2rzYtnC9wUVmEXo39cNwk= X-Received: by 2002:a05:6000:2c01:b0:43e:a73e:cc98 with SMTP id ffacd0b85a97d-4515cf11bb8mr16650920f8f.23.1778224357508; Fri, 08 May 2026 00:12:37 -0700 (PDT) Received: from FRSMI25-LASER.home (2a01cb001331aa00a2e4fb7b0d887544.ipv6.abo.wanadoo.fr. [2a01:cb00:1331:aa00:a2e4:fb7b:d88:7544]) by smtp.gmail.com with ESMTPSA id ffacd0b85a97d-4548ec6be40sm2415545f8f.12.2026.05.08.00.12.37 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 08 May 2026 00:12:37 -0700 (PDT) From: Yoann Congal To: openembedded-core@lists.openembedded.org Subject: [OE-core][wrynose 37/52] wpa-supplicant: remove obsolete explicit debug packaging Date: Fri, 8 May 2026 09:11:30 +0200 Message-ID: X-Mailer: git-send-email 2.47.3 In-Reply-To: References: MIME-Version: 1.0 List-Id: X-Webhook-Received: from 45-33-107-173.ip.linodeusercontent.com [45.33.107.173]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Fri, 08 May 2026 07:12:40 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/236679 From: Ross Burton The .debug directories are packaged automatically by default, so this is redundant. This recipe packages the plugin debug symbols into their own packages, there's no real advantage to doing this so remove that logic. Signed-off-by: Ross Burton Signed-off-by: Richard Purdie (cherry picked from commit e5ff03b951ffb00b66a7812a9762315a99155d0c) Signed-off-by: Yoann Congal --- .../wpa-supplicant/wpa-supplicant_2.11.bb | 7 ------- 1 file changed, 7 deletions(-) diff --git a/meta/recipes-connectivity/wpa-supplicant/wpa-supplicant_2.11.bb b/meta/recipes-connectivity/wpa-supplicant/wpa-supplicant_2.11.bb index 7c7a8bd9c13..71bfb090a0a 100644 --- a/meta/recipes-connectivity/wpa-supplicant/wpa-supplicant_2.11.bb +++ b/meta/recipes-connectivity/wpa-supplicant/wpa-supplicant_2.11.bb @@ -113,13 +113,11 @@ PACKAGES += "${PN}-plugins" ALLOW_EMPTY:${PN}-plugins = "1" PACKAGES_DYNAMIC += "^${PN}-plugin-.*$" -NOAUTOPACKAGEDEBUG = "1" FILES:${PN}-passphrase = "${sbindir}/wpa_passphrase" FILES:${PN}-cli = "${sbindir}/wpa_cli" FILES:${PN}-lib = "${libdir}/libwpa_client*${SOLIBSDEV}" FILES:${PN} += "${datadir}/dbus-1/system-services/* ${systemd_system_unitdir}/*" -FILES:${PN}-dbg += "${sbindir}/.debug ${libdir}/.debug" CONFFILES:${PN} += "${sysconfdir}/wpa_supplicant.conf" @@ -130,14 +128,9 @@ SYSTEMD_AUTO_ENABLE = "disable" python split_wpa_supplicant_libs () { libdir = d.expand('${libdir}/wpa_supplicant') - dbglibdir = os.path.join(libdir, '.debug') - split_packages = do_split_packages(d, libdir, r'^(.*)\.so', '${PN}-plugin-%s', 'wpa_supplicant %s plugin', prepend=True) - split_dbg_packages = do_split_packages(d, dbglibdir, r'^(.*)\.so', '${PN}-plugin-%s-dbg', 'wpa_supplicant %s plugin - Debugging files', prepend=True, extra_depends='${PN}-dbg') - if split_packages: pn = d.getVar('PN') d.setVar('RRECOMMENDS:' + pn + '-plugins', ' '.join(split_packages)) - d.appendVar('RRECOMMENDS:' + pn + '-dbg', ' ' + ' '.join(split_dbg_packages)) } PACKAGESPLITFUNCS += "split_wpa_supplicant_libs"